Citywide Moving — Vetted & Verified by HireAHelper 

To make sure you get reliable, professional service, HireAHelper thoroughly vets every provider on our platform — including Citywide Moving. Before providers can accept their first booking, they must pass background checks, verify their business and payment information, agree to our service standards, and demonstrate a strong review history. From there, we hold them to it: providers are continuously monitored on job completion rates, customer ratings, pricing consistency, and compliance.

Specifically hired movers to unload my container because the last thing in the container was my upright piano, which I specified in my order. The HireAHelper system said I needed to hire two guys for my move. Ok so I did. (It took two guys to move the piano into the container when it was packed so I didn’t think anything of it). When they got to the piano, which was the last item in the container, these guys start making excuses why they can’t move it. First they wanted to bring it into the house and wheel it across a wood floor, which every legitimate mover knows you don’t do unless you want to damage the floor. I said hell no. Then they tell me they didn’t bring heavy item straps (which are default equipment for legitimate movers). So how did they think they were going to move a piano that’s stated on the order? Then they tell me they need another person to help pick it up. Funny how when I placed the order for the move, I stated I needed a piano moved and the system recommended I hire two guys for that. Now I needed to hire three guys? Basically what it came down to is they didn’t want to have to move the piano. They didn’t need two guys. I had two guys carry the piano into the container when it was loaded. It was a cop out because they wanted to go home. So basically I paid over $400 to have two guys move a couple of mattresses into my house because honestly I could have just moved everything else. So now I need to hire movers again to move my piano from my garage into my house. Thanks City Movers! Your guys are stellar.

Mover's response:
We are sorry you feel that way. However, the fact is we did not say that we needed three movers to pick the piano up because we did that ourselves with two men and took it out of your pod and placed it into your garage. We said we needed a third mover to get it up your stairs (which you forgot to mention) because your piano was a very old oversized extra heavy upright piano. Much larger than the standard size pianos. As legitimate movers being in this business for 33 years, we know clear as day as well as every other moving company knows that the standard way to move a piano is strapped onto a four wheel dolly. Which is exactly what we did. Now that we cleared that up, your house was a very tiny house with very small corners to navigate around, which made it impossible for that piano to get into your house without you having to take down the porch railings. In which case holding that piano up that high on the stairs to get a straight shot into your house will require a third guy. We’re sorry that your house was simply built too small to navigate your huge piano in there, but we did move your piano with no problem at all whatsoever where it would fit. Have a great day!
